Hello, I'm using the version of tracker included with Ubuntu 8.04. I also use Evolution and have indexing turned on for 68,000 emails. When tracker restarts (for example when the computer restarts), it seems to perform some sort of cleanup of the index. Since much of the email I receive is spam, these indexed emails must be deleted from tracker's index.
Here's where I think things go wrong. Upon starting tracker in a fresh session, CPU usage spikes to 100% and stays there for hours. Running trackerd with the --verbose=2 option shows one of these lines appearing every 15 seconds: deleting email email://[EMAIL PROTECTED]/INBOX;uid=289018 Is tracker re-indexing the database after each row is deleted? If so, it would be much better to delete emails from the index in batches.
